Cellular selection and partial characterisation of gladiolus cell lines resistant to culture filtrate of Fusarium oxysporum

The pedicel explants of Gladiolus cv. Amsterdam were cultured on MS medium supplemented with NAA (10 mg/1) and kinetin (0.5mg/1) for callus initiation. For multiplication of callus MS medium supplemented with 2,4D (2mg/1) was used. Different concentrations of culture filtrate of Fusarium oxysporum f.sp. gladioli were added into the culture medium for selection of resistant cell lines. Upon incubation for six weeks, the resistant clones were selected at 10 concentration of culture filtrate. The selected clones were cultured on medium devoid of culture filtrate for 3 weeks and then characterized using biochemical parameters. Selected cell lines revealed a higher protein content, phenol content, total sugar and reducing sugar content compared to non-selected cell lines. In the non-selected cell lines higher activities of phenylalanine ammonia lyase and tyrosine ammonia lyase were found.
